Davy Strong was penniless, friendless and as raw and green as the vast frontier itself when he arrived in Boston in the winter of 1775. But within a few harrowing, tumultuous moths Davy Strong would be one of the first breed of men. A man caught between the old world and the new; between the loyalties of tradition and the loyalties of the heart.

This is his story—and the story of the women who loved him: the hot-blooded Isabella, who took what she wanted, but who couldn't control her young lover; her strong-willed daughter, Martha, who could forgive him anything; even loving her own mother; and the Indian girl who lay buried in the wilderness with all his boyhood dreams.
